Chapter 6: The Serpent Coils
- Rust and Monk rush to the mine with some muscle to try and fix the situation which is spinning out of control
- the miners aren't receptive to Rust's demands; one of them gets shot down when he tries charging Rust
- Rust and Monk get in a large bucket and have Tiny raise them up above the crowd
- Jeffers shows up and starts the bucket moving again; Monk tries to shoot the controls but only hits Jeffers, killing him
- the bucket reaches the top and spills Rust and Monk to their deaths
- peace is restored in Copper City
- last chapter seems very Rust focused even though Hal is the main character

It Rhymes with Lust - Ch 5
Chapter 5: The Counterplot
- Using all the information he has gathered about Rust and her underhanded business, Hal spends the night writing an expose which he gets finished in time for the next day's paper
- Jeffers tries to make the most of the expose to his own benefit
- the Times publishes an extra edition claiming that what the Express is printing is all lies

It Rhymes with Lust - Ch 4
Chapter 4: Indecision
- Hal finally seems to wise up
- first Hal makes up with Audrey; then they go to see what Rust is up to; they suspect she is planning to kill Jeffers
- they confront Rust but this time Audrey is the one who winds up rushing off and Hal is the one who sticks around
- Hal seems to be torn between Audrey on the one hand and Rust and drinking on the other; for the moment he seems to side with Rust but maybe that's just an act
- on orders from Rust, Hal helps One of her henchmen (Tiny) to dump the unconscious Jeffers on the outskirts of town, then he heads back to his place
- there's message waiting for him from Rust telling him to come on over, he decides not to and is about to have a drink when he sees one of Audrey's gloves that she left behind when she ran off
- he holds the bottle in one hand and the glove in the other trying to decide between the two; the chapter ends with him smashing the bottle
- Rust's declaration about what Hal really wants
- Monk trying to get some from Rust and being rebuffed

It Rhymes with Lust - Ch 3
By Drake Waller, Matt Baker, and Ray Osrin
OGN
Chapter 3: Deadly Female
- Rust ruthlessly bargains with Jeffers and then with X
-At first Hal refuses to believe the evidence but then, after a little convincing from Audrey he starts to see the light: Rust is behind the bombing
- Hal gets another visit from the cabbie who has scoop for him about Rust this time, her mining company is running a very unsafe operation which is putting many lives in danger
- Hal and the cabbie go to investigate the mines themselves and almost get killed; Hal plans to do a story about the unsafe mining operation but then he gets a call from Rust
- Hal goes to visit Rust who claims that it's Jeffers fault, he is in charge of safety at the mine, she knew nothing; Hal starts to come around to her perspective when Audrey walks in just in time to catch Hal and Rust embracing
- Rust tells Hal to take a walk and then slaps Audrey around
- not great, a but formulaic
- there was one part that read kind of weird where I didn't follow Hal's logic
- it seems like Hal's heart belongs to whomever he has been with most recently

It Rhymes with Lust - Ch 2
By Drake Waller, Matt Baker, and Ray Osrin
OGN
Chapter 2: Caught in the Web
- a week has gone by and although he hasn't seen her Hal can't get Audrey out if his head; then she comes to see him at the office and takes him back to her place, for lunch
- Hal gets a call from an unknown person who has damning information about Marcus Jeffers; the mystery man turns out to be the cabbie who have him a ride from the train station when he first arrived in town
- Hal calls Rust and tells her he's got something on Jeffers; she insists on meeting at a cabin; he (unsuccessfully) tries to play it cool but quickly succumbs to Rusts charms and finds himself being unfaithful to Audrey
- Rust uses the information she gets about Jeffers to order a hit on one of his gambling dens; this is after telling Hal to investigate the club

It Rhymes with Lust - Ch 1
By Arnold Drake, Reed Waller, Matt Baker, Ray Osrin
OGN
Chapter 1
- Hal Weber rolls into Copper City on the same day that Rust Masson is burying her husband; he is there at her request
- Hal and Rust were a couple 10 years ago; she left him; she needs his help discrediting a local politician; Hal also learns that Rust owns both of the town's newspapers, the Times and the Express, the one he works for although it's a well kept secret that she owns the Express which is critical of her
- Audrey, Rust's step-daughter, wants nothing to do with her step-mother, and seems to fall hard for Hal or does she, maybe it's all just a ploy
- so far I like it; not too sophisticated but I like the way that Hal gets himself caught between Audrey and Rust so quickly
